The average train between Bordeaux and Lamballe takes 9h 12m and the fastest train takes 6h 12m. The train service runs several times per day from Bordeaux to Lamballe.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run 4 times a day between Bordeaux and Lamballe. The earliest departure is at 6:58 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Bordeaux is at 8:58 PM which arrives into Lamballe at 12:15 PM. All services require a transfer at St Pierre Des Corps and take an average of 9h 12m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ct train from Bordeaux to Lamballe. However, there are services departing from Bordeaux station and arriving at Lamballe station via St Pierre Des Corps.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 12m.
Bordeaux to Lamballe train services, operated by TGV inOui, depart from Bordeaux St Jean station.
Bordeaux to Lamballe train services, operated by TGV inOui, arrive at Lamballe station.

The distance between Bordeaux and Lamballe is 429.6 km. The road distance is 689 km.
You can take a train from Bordeaux St Jean to Lamballe via St Pierre Des Corps, Angers St Laud, and Rennes in around 6h 35m.
